OTD 1985: Running Up That Hill (A Deal with God)
At No.3, Kate Bush’s 2nd-biggest hit
…Then 22 years later, No.1 all round the world!
A momentous, magnificently record-smashing record

Happy International Non-Binary People’s Day!

(Celebrated on this day as it’s the midpoint between International Women’s Day and International Men’s Day. Gender can be more fluid than one point, but calendars are like that)

Love to all my enby friends and theys and thems.
